Tractor death in Douglas County

OSAKIS, Minn. (KNSI) Authorities in Douglas County say a 73-year-old man who was found unconscious near his tractor has died.
Deputies responded to an emergency call Tuesday evening to an address near Osakis. A family member found Douglas Rutten unconscious and injured on the ground.
Deputies say it's not clear whether Rutten fell off the tractor and was injured, or if he had a medical issue that caused him to fall before getting on the tractor.He was declared dead at the scene.
